How Does the Handling of a 150cc Scooter Trike Differ from Two-Wheel Scooters?
When it comes to personal transportation, scooter enthusiasts often find themselves debating between two-wheel scooters and the increasingly popular three-wheel variants, specifically 150cc scooter trikes. While both options offer unique benefits, one of the key considerations is how their handling differs. Understanding these differences can help potential riders make an informed decision based on their needs and riding preferences. Stability and Balance Two-Wheel Scooters Two-wheel scooters require the rider to maintain balance, especially when starting, stopping, and maneuvering at low speeds. This need for balance makes them agile and nimble, ideal for weaving through traffic and navigating tight spaces. However, this also means that riders must be more attentive and skilled, particularly in situations involving sudden stops or sharp turns. 150cc Scooter Trikes In contrast, 150cc scooter trikes offer superior stability due to their three-wheel design.
